Man Sentenced To Life In Prison For Killing Wife After She Searched: “What To Do If Your Husband Is Upset You Are Pregnant”

Beau Rothwell of Creve Coeur, Missouri has been convicted in the murder of the November 29th, 2019 killing of his wife, Jennifer Rothwell. She was six weeks pregnant.

The 31-year-old was found guilty of first-degree murder, tampering with evidence, and abandoning a corpse. He was sentenced to life in prison without parole.

On the day of her death, Jennifer Rothwell confronted her husband about an affair he was having with another woman. She had discovered his infidelity after they learned about her pregnancy. This sent him into a violent rage, where he began hitting her in the back of her head with a mallet. She eventually lost consciousness and fell down a flight of stairs.

After dumping her body about 45 miles away, Beau Rothwell reported Jennifer missing. Organized with her family and friends, he participated in search parties looking for her.

Police, later on, searched their house and found bottles of bleach, along with a wet and blood-stained carpet, that matched the victim’s DNA. After he was arrested, they were able to find and check her cellphone. Her search history showed she had looked up “what to do if your husband is upset you are pregnant.”

Referring to his attack against her as being “in the heat of the moment,” Rothwell apologized to Jennifer’s family during the sentencing hearing, telling them that he “thinks about her every single day.”

After Beau Rothwell sentence was announced, he declared that he plans to appeal the decision.
